    .....has become very picky.

    He owns a Mark.I Cambridge Audio Transport which, up until recently, was working fine. However, if the unit is left switched off for a while it won't play any discs until it has 'warmed up' for 30 minutes or so. I thought it may be moisture on the laser but his house isn't particularly susceptable to excess humidity. Could it be a mechanism or circuit problem ?
